  1. Many thanks for your suggestions. I tried a lower res on the side screens, it gave a few FPS back, but not that much. I was not able to get Nvidia Surround mode to work however. I couldn't get the Timings match between my iMac 27" (2560 native) and my BenQ 27" (1920 native). Though the iMac has a 1920 res configuration, it has a larger pixel area and applying the BenQs' 1920 Timing parameters would just mack it go black. Bottom line is I'll have to trade my iMac for a PC. I am leaning towards an i7, 16Gb RAM, GTX-1070 8 GB + the same BenQ monitor. Please let me know if you reckon this does not suffice for a smooth 3-screen rendering, or you think this is not a future-proof enough setup. Cheers.

  4. Hi All, I am running P3D v4.3 PRO on an iMAC i7, 32Gb, 4Gb NVIDIA, 128GbSSD/1Tb via Boot Camp (with Win10 on an external 240Gb SSD). With most settings between Low and Medium, everything runs smoothly and I get 60FPS. This however collapses to 20FPS- when in multi-screen. I have Left and Right views (through View Group on 2 separate monitors off my iMac) and this seems to be killing it - though I am unable to see this necessarily reflected in GPU and CPU stats. Is this performance drop normal and is there any solution to it? Would a similar setup on a PC yield higher performance in a 3-screen configuration? The most taxing setting I have seems to be Scenery Complexity (medium) but I need a quite good terrain detail level as I use P3D as a training platform for my PPL. Other add-ons on my iMAC are ASCA, U Live Traffic and my home plate scenery. I also have a Garmin G1000 sim on a separate PC but this is through WIFI. Thanks for any help and hardware advice you could provide (happy to switch over to a PC-based setup, but I need to make sure what config to go for then).
